Cabbage loopers are emerging, so it’s time to start adding BT to the rotation! Cabbage loopers are the smaller white moths and their caterpillars can eat/ruin leaves of plants. They especially like cabbage, kales, collards, broccoli, and brussel sprouts. The green caterpillars are what cause the damage and they are the target for BT application.

BT is a bacteria (organic) that targets caterpillars without harming beneficial insects. I sprayed it on my plants in the evening and made a point to spray all areas of the plant. This product must be ingested to work, so application all over the plant is key.

If you’re seeing cabbage loppers I highly recommend starting BT now, and apply as needed through the season.

One thing about gardening is you don’t always get instant gratification.

These strawberry plants are just babies and they’re not ready for fruit production. Picking off the flowers will allow the plant to form a stronger root system and increase future yields in years to come. 🍓🍓
